Lionel Richie and Earth, Wind & Fire Announce 2026 North American Tour

Detroit, MI – Legendary singer Lionel Richie and iconic band Earth, Wind & Fire have announced their joint “Sing A Song All Night Long Tour,” set to begin on June 24, 2026, in Saint Paul, Minnesota, and conclude on August 14, 2026, in Austin, Texas.

Tour Details

The 26-city tour will feature performances in major cities across the United States and Canada, including:

  • June 24, 2026: Saint Paul, MN – Grand Casino Arena
  • June 26, 2026: Chicago, IL – United Center
  • June 27, 2026: Columbus, OH – Schottenstein Center
  • June 30, 2026: Pittsburgh, PA – PPG Paints Arena
  • July 1, 2026: Detroit, MI – Little Caesars Arena
  • July 4, 2026: Toronto, ON – Scotiabank Arena
  • July 5, 2026: Montreal, QC – Centre Bell
  • July 8, 2026: Boston, MA – TD Garden
  • July 10, 2026: Hartford, CT – PeoplesBank Arena
  • July 11, 2026: New York, NY – Madison Square Garden
  • July 14, 2026: Belmont Park, NY – UBS Arena
  • July 16, 2026: Philadelphia, PA – Xfinity Mobile Arena
  • July 18, 2026: Greensboro, NC – First Horizon Coliseum
  • July 19, 2026: Atlanta, GA – State Farm Arena
  • July 22, 2026: Tampa, FL – Benchmark International Arena
  • July 24, 2026: Hollywood, FL – Hard Rock Live
  • July 25, 2026: Orlando, FL – Kia Center
  • July 28, 2026: San Antonio, TX – Frost Bank Center
  • July 29, 2026: Dallas, TX – American Airlines Center
  • July 31, 2026: Denver, CO – Ball Arena
  • August 3, 2026: Seattle, WA – Climate Pledge Arena
  • August 6, 2026: San Francisco, CA – Chase Center
  • August 8, 2026: Palm Desert, CA – Acrisure Arena
  • August 9, 2026: Los Angeles, CA – Intuit Dome
  • August 11, 2026: Phoenix, AZ – Mortgage Matchup Center
  • August 14, 2026: Austin, TX – Moody Center

Ticket Information

Tickets will be available starting with a Citi presale on Tuesday, January 27, 2026, at 10 a.m. local time. Additional presales will run throughout the week ahead of the general onsale beginning Friday, January 30, 2026, at 10 a.m. local time. For more information, visit Live Nation’s official website.

About the Artists

Lionel Richie is a renowned singer, songwriter, and producer with a career spanning several decades. He has sold over 125 million albums worldwide and has been honored with multiple Grammy Awards. Some of his most recognizable hits include “All Night Long,” “Hello,” and “Say You, Say Me.”

Earth, Wind & Fire is one of the best-selling bands of all time, known for their dynamic performances and fusion of various musical genres, including R&B, soul, and funk. Their timeless classics continue to resonate with audiences worldwide.

Background

This tour marks the second collaboration between Lionel Richie and Earth, Wind & Fire, following their successful co-headlining tour in 2023. Fans can look forward to an evening filled with hit songs and memorable performances from both artists.
